If you want to get small particles, you’ll need a tighter net. Or grab some pantyhose, like I did.
Overall, it’s worth the $22. But, the net it comes with is only good for leaves and larger debris.
One thing I noticed while using it. If you don’t make sure it’s flat on the bottom of the pool, it will shoot the stuff out of the side instead of through the net.
I noticed a lot of small particles were coming through to the surface of the pool. So I cut a piece of pantyhose and put it on. (Through the center and wrapped up around the edge.). It stayed on without any issues. And it manages to grab everything I was trying to get off of the bottom. I shared some photos for comparison.
